8 must-have smartphone apps for your Malta visit
From weather forecasts and travel apps to the best beaches and nearest Wi-Fi hotspots, these apps will make your stay on the Maltese Islands a breeze!

1. Whichbeach
Summer is here and it’s time to hit the beach, but which one? This handy app suggests beaches in Malta and Gozo where the conditions are best on any given day.
apps
2. Tallinja 
Access real time information about the bus service thanks to this free app by Malta Public Transport.
apps
3. MCA Malta Free WiFi 
Find free and public Wi-Fi spots in open spaces, cafés, bars and restaurants, pin-pointed on a map for easy viewing, thanks to this app by the Malta Communications Authority.
apps
4. Malta Weather
Get up-to-date, accurate and easy-to-read seven-day forecasts of Malta’s weather with this app, so you can plan your days ahead.

5. Nextbike Malta
This fantastic public bike-sharing system from all around the world is now in Malta, with bikes available 24/7. The free app to make renting bikes as quick and easy, so you can get cycling!

8. eCabs Malta
Malta’s leading minicab company’s app allows you to book a cab on the go, at any time, and anywhere! It really has never been easier to book your ride home.

9. Maltese dictionary

This free app is a useful tool for non-Maltese speakers on the island. In the unlikely event that you’re having trouble communicating (most people here speak English), simply key in what you want to say, and hey presto!
